    Is there a way to keep your second baseman from vacating his position on a steal when you have no intention of throwing to second?
    Example game is tied in the bottom of third (events game). Two outs runner on third. He has a weak hitter on deck so I intentionally walk the batter. I know a steal is coming but want to keep my fielder in position for a bunt or weak hit to the right side. He steals, My fielder goes to cover second vacating the entire right side and a check swing weak hit rolls right through the vacated hole to end the game. Anyone know how I keep the fielder from leaving his position?
